The UAE’s next public holiday is just around the corner — and it might bring with it a long weekend.
While that’s already a welcome mid-week break, not many residents know that the UAE Cabinet has the authority to shift certain public holidays to create longer weekends.

According to Cabinet Resolution No. (27) of 2024, the Cabinet may officially move public holidays to either the start or end of the workweek to optimise rest days and benefit both workers and institutions.
However, there’s one exception: Eid holidays are fixed and cannot be moved.
If the Prophet’s (PBUH) birthday falls on a Thursday, the day off could potentially be shifted to Friday. This would give both public and private sector employees a three-day weekend — depending on how the Cabinet chooses to apply the rule this year.
Until the official announcement is made, nothing is confirmed — but the possibility of a long weekend is definitely on the table.
